Pregnant women are wise to avoid __________ to reduce the likelihood of mercury exposure.

Pregnant women are advised to avoid eating long-lived predatory types of fish like sharks, swordfish and albacore tuna. These types of fish contain high levels of mercury and may have harmful effects on the fetus. Avoiding these types of fish could also reduce the risk of mercury exposure/poisoning.
